## Account Recovery — Trailnote Offline Mode

When a surveyor's Trailnote app has been offline for 30+ days, their local credentials expire and sync refuses to resume. Don't make them wipe the device — all their unsynced field data lives there! Instead, open the support console, pick "Offline Reinstate," and enter their handle. The console will ask for the support team's shared recovery passphrase before issuing a reinstatement token. Use the one below.

unlock words, bagaf-fajeg: zorael-kelax-fraath-quenix-eliok-sileth-aldmir-wenir-druiel

Subject: Fernbrook SFTP cut-over complete

Team — the partner drop moved off the old Halloway host last night. Transfers from Fernbrook now land on the new ingest box; the legacy path is read-only until month end. Polling interval and retention are unchanged. For reference, the new endpoint runs with these configuration values:

config for bahop-fajep:
DRUATH_PIN=4501
DRUATH_TENANT=briwyn
DRUATH_METRICS_HOST=metrics.druath.brasksoft.test
DRUATH_SEAL=seal_7d2e069d
DRUATH_STANDBY_TEAM=olieth

## Onboarding — Markdown Pipeline (Inkmere)

Inkmere docs render through a three-stage pipeline: parse, sanitize, emit. Releases rebuild all templates; never hot-patch emitted HTML. Broken renders usually mean a sanitizer rule change — check the rules diff first. The render cluster only accepts builds from the release channel, and every build artifact must be signed before upload. Sign artifacts with the deploy key below.

release key, hafop-tajef: bky13_s2vaFVNJTHfBL